From Higher Ed Dive - The number of international students seeking admission to colleges through the Common Application rose by 63% over a nearly decade-long period, according to new data from the organization.

The data shows 31,456 international applicants used the Common App in the 2014-15 academic year, jumping to 51,426 applicants in 2020-21. A similar rise, 61%, came in domestic applicants using the Common App — an online portal enabling students to apply to more than 1,000 member institutions — during this period.

Over each of the eight years, international applicants comprised between 4% and 5% of the overall applicant pool. They submitted about 13% of all applications.
